Transaction 8d784f5f08265080510095666c2c36ddb6d78a1eae5f959bfe1c9131283a62ea
1 Input
1 Output
-
8d784f5f08265080510095666c2c36ddb6d78a1eae5f959bfe1c9131283a62ea:0
- value
- 622111
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6e69b3bb30a22aeef43d6c15405affa540c977ac OP_EQUAL
- address
- 3BkpsxHc2UpppPnLNfLExxzg8wQevfozM1